Jen and Ryan

VeggL is a passion project of Jen & Ryan. Both vegan (Jen since 2012, Ryan since 2018), they wanted to help other vegans & plant based folks through an incredibly frustrating process… trying to figure out what and how to order vegan at chain restaurants, airports, sports venues, and amusement parks in the United States.
